Thickness

The thickness is an important aspect when selecting a mattress topper, as it can alter how comfortable the mattress feels. Toppers come in a range of thicknesses that range from 2 inches and 4 inches. A thicker model could be preferred by heavier individuals or those who suffer from back pain. Lighter sleepers might prefer a thinner model to improve their sleep quality.

A memory foam mattress toppers foam mattress is one of the most popular options among our panelists as it is well-known for its capacity to provide support and change the firmness level of a mattress. This type of mattress typically has a 3 to 4-inch profile and is ideal for changing the feel of an old or worn-out mattress that may show indications of indentation.

If you're looking to increase the comfort of a comfortable mattress, then you should look for a thin mattress topper made of natural materials such as wool or cotton. These toppers are breathable, and regulate body temperature naturally. They also provide a decent amount of cushioning without increasing the height of the mattress.

If you're looking for a thin mattress topper, ensure that it is certified by CertiPUR US as having low levels of off gassing. Also, make sure that the topper has not been treated with chemicals that can cause irritation. Other important features to consider are the material and the density of the foam. A higher density indicates that it has more durability and can adapt better to the sleeper's shape and also provide a more firm feel.

Hygiene

They are more dense than mattresses pads. While mattresses are thin and can be put on top of the bed as a fitted sheet, toppers sit directly on the mattress. They also have the ability to dramatically change the feel of your mattress--from firm support to pillow-top softness. Because they are more vulnerable to spills, sweat and allergens than mattresses, they will require more frequent cleaning.

bedbric-mattress-topper-double-bed-4-inches-thick-soft-fluffy-quilted-double-mattress-topper-hypoallergenic-mattress-toppers-with-elastic-straps-5754.jpgMost toppers can't be machine-washed because the spinning and agitation of washing machines could cause the degradation of their rubber or foam materials. However, a few of the toppers in this selection come with washable covers that are removable and washable. If you want to to clean your toppers in the machine, check for labels such as "machine wash" or "washable cover."

Consider the certifications of the mattress topper, and also its environmental impact. If you opt for a topper made with synthetic materials, you should choose one that is certified by CertiPUR-US to be free of high levels of off-gassing chemicals. If you're looking to use a topper that has down fill, make sure you choose a model that meets Responsible Down Standard (RDS) guidelines.

For the best results, make sure you clean your mattress topper regularly by vacuuming both sides of the fabric with a power-nozzle attachment or a brush tool with a soft brush. This is particularly important in order to remove odors as well as prevent the growth of mildew or mold. If your topper has been soiled, blot the stain with white towels until as much liquid is removed as you can. Sprinkle baking soda on top of the topper and allow it to sit for eight hours before vacuuming it again. This can lessen odors and remove urine stains or other liquids.

When you are storing your mattress topper place it in a cool, dry space away from sunlight and heat sources. Consider adding a moisture-absorbing mattress pad under your mattress topper if you have to store it for a lengthy duration. You can also air-dry your mattress topper regularly by opening windows or placing fans in the area in which it is stored.
